Eggstravaganza

First Flight #37
Beginner FriendlySolidity
100 EXP
View results
Submission Details
Severity: low
Invalid

Public Functions Not Used Internally

Summary

There are three functions in EggVault.sol that are marked public, but not used internally. Consider marking them as external to save gas costs:

Found in src/EggVault.sol Line: 29
function depositEgg(uint256 tokenId, address depositor) public {
Found in src/EggVault.sol Line: 38
function withdrawEgg(uint256 tokenId) public {
Found in src/EggVault.sol Line: 50
function isEggDeposited(uint256 tokenId) public view returns (bool) {
Updates

Lead Judging Commences

m3dython Lead Judge about 2 months ago
Submission Judgement Published
Invalidated
Reason: Non-acceptable severity
Assigned finding tags:

Gas optimization

Strategy to save gas and minimize transaction costs

Support

FAQs

Can't find an answer? Chat with us on Discord, Twitter or Linkedin.